Sun-Spider, a.k.a. Charlotte Webber, is a character who made her first appearance in the Marvel Universe in Spider-Verse #6 (2020). Created by Dayn Broder, the winner of Marvel’s Spidersona contest, Sun-Spider has Ehlers-Danlos Syndrome (EDS), a condition that affects her joints and connective tissue. Like many with EDS, she has hypermobility and uses mobility aids such as crutches or a wheelchair when needed. Sun-Spider’s story in Edge of Spider-Verse #4 (2022), titled “Prom and Circumstance,” addresses the issue of disability representation by highlighting the challenges faced by disabled heroes and advocating for their inclusion in comics and media. This groundbreaking character challenges harmful norms and paves the way for more disabled heroes to be seen in the future.
